Winter Lanterns, City Lights: A Tapestry of Japan’s Essence
Day 1: Arrival in Tokyo – The Start of a Japanese Odyssey
Arrive in Japan’s vibrant capital, ready to embark on a memorable adventure.
Arrival at Narita/Haneda International Airport
Overnight stay in Tokyo

Day 2: Palaces, Flavours, and Electric Streets in Tokyo
Discover iconic views and lively districts as you taste authentic Tokyo.
Imperial Palace
Explore Tsukiji Outer Market , lunch at the market
Dive into Akihabara’s pop culture
Wander Shibuya district
Overnight stay in Tokyo

Day 3: Spiritual Sites and Winter Wonders in Saitama
Explore serene temples and marvel at snowy icicle landscapes.
Menuma Shotenzan Temple
Savour Kumagaya Udon noodles, lunch included
Witness Misotsuchi Icicles
Overnight stay in Omiya
Day 4: Gunma’s Ski Slopes and Soothing Hot Springs
Experience the joy of skiing and then unwind in a traditional onsen.
Kusatsu Onsen Ski Resort
Soak at Kusatsu Onsen (Hot Spring)
Overnight stay at Kusatsu Onsen

Day 5: Nagano’s Spiritual Heritage and Snow Monkeys
Embrace both tranquillity and wild encounters in Nagano prefecture.
Explore Zenkoji Temple
Soba Buckwheat Noodles, lunch included
Meet the Snow Monkeys at Jigokudani Yaen-koen
Overnight stay in Nagano

Day 6: Niigata’s Sake, Villas, and Winter Landscapes
Enjoy a taste of sake and scenic beauty—check access before venturing to snowy rice terraces.
Asahi-shuzo Sake Brewing Co., Ltd.
Japanese Sake experience
Visit Shoraikaku villa
Hoshitoge Rice Terrace (seasonal, inquire before visiting)
Overnight stay in Nagaoka

Day 7: Niigata’s Historic Breweries and Artistic Gardens
Discover sake breweries and immerse yourself in art and nature.
Musashino Shuzo / Ski Masamune
Buddhist artwork, Japanese gardens & modern architecture
Lunch at Tanimura Art Museum & Gyokusuien Gardens
Overnight stay in Itoigawa

Day 8: Toyama’s Sushi and Scenic Valleys
Relish Toyama’s culinary specialities and dramatic natural settings.
Taste fresh Toyama Bay Sushi, lunch included
Stroll Yamacho Valley
Visit Zuiryuji Temple
Cruise through Shogawa Gorge
Overnight stay at Shogawa Onsen (Hot Spring)

Day 9: Gifu’s Heritage Villages and Takayama Traditions
Walk among ancient architecture and festival artistry in Gifu.
Explore Gokayama Gassho-zukuri Village (World Heritage)
Old Quarter of Takayama
Morning Market
Hida Shunkei Lacquerware
Lunch with Takayama Ramen
Make a Sarubobo doll
Takayama Festival Floats Exhibition Hall
Overnight stay in Takayama

Day 10: Ishikawa’s Gardens, Museums, and Artistic Alleys
Blend history, art, and vibrant districts in Kanazawa’s scenic cityscape.
Higashi-Chaya Teahouse District
Kenroku-en Garden lunch included
D. T. Suzuki Museum
Kanazawa 21st Century Museum of Contemporary Art
Overnight stay in Kanazawa

Day 11: Fukui’s Temples and Clan History
Explore spiritual retreats and the relics of ancient families in Fukui.
Eiheiji Temple
Lunch with Echizen Soba
Ichijodani Asakura Clan Ruins
Yokokan Garden
Overnight stay in Fukui

Day 12: Shiga’s Shrines and Mountaintop Serenity
Discover spiritual icons and rejuvenate in the soothing waters of scenic Shiga.
Shirahige Jinja Shrine
Lunch at a local restaurant
See Hieizan Enryaku-ji Temple
Relax at Ogoto Onsen (Hot Spring)
Overnight stay at Ogoto Onsen

Day 13: Kyoto’s Golden Temples and Swordmaking Art
Revel in Kyoto’s iconic sites and experience authentic craftsmanship.
Kinkaku-ji Temple (The Golden Pavilion)
Visit Masahiro Tantoujou Sword Forge
Overnight stay in Kyoto

Day 14: Osaka’s Urban Heritage and Night Lights
Unite castle history and bustling city scenes before joining the Festival of Lights.
Osaka Castle Park
Osaka Museum of History
Kuromon Market
Hozenji Yokocho (Temple Alleyway)
Dotonbori Area
Festival of the Lights in Osaka
Overnight stay in Osaka
Day 15: Osaka – A Fond Farewell
Bid goodbye to Japan as you head for Kansai International Airport.
Transfer for departure at Kansai International Airport
The rate for this itinerary package will be: JPY 400000 to JPY 700000 per person onwards.
